Filter within selections above. Data is not available for all products.
Code: KF21001
Your Price: £81.42 exc VATRRP: £81.42 exc VAT
Pack size: 1
Stock: In stock 2,250
Code: KF21002
Your Price: £8.63 exc VATRRP: £8.63 exc VAT
Pack size: 1
Stock: In stock 1,466
Code: KF21003
Your Price: £4.73 exc VATRRP: £4.73 exc VAT
Pack size: 1
Stock: In stock 1,662
Code: KF21004
Your Price: £78.98 exc VATRRP: £78.98 exc VAT
Pack size: 1
Stock: In stock 366
Code: KF21017
Your Price: £21.18 exc VATRRP: £21.18 exc VAT
Pack size: 1
Stock: In stock 297
Code: KF21018
Your Price: £21.63 exc VATRRP: £21.63 exc VAT
Pack size: 1
Stock: In stock 371
Code: KF21660
Your Price: £76.79 exc VATRRP: £76.79 exc VAT
Pack size: 10
Stock: In stock 1,148
Code: KF21661
Your Price: £36.77 exc VATRRP: £36.77 exc VAT
Pack size: 10
Stock: In stock 177
Code: KF21663
Your Price: £179.53 exc VATRRP: £179.53 exc VAT
Pack size: 10
Stock: In stock 56
Code: KF21665
Your Price: £69.22 exc VATRRP: £69.22 exc VAT
Pack size: 10
Stock: In stock 2,072
Code: KF21666
Your Price: £59.48 exc VATRRP: £59.48 exc VAT
Pack size: 20
Stock: In stock 69
Code: KF21738
Your Price: £110.31 exc VATRRP: £110.31 exc VAT
Pack size: 10
Stock: In stock 266
Code: KF22001
Your Price: £20.91 exc VATRRP: £20.91 exc VAT
Pack size: 1
Stock: In stock 732
Code: KF23010
Your Price: £34.84 exc VATRRP: £34.84 exc VAT
Pack size: 50
Stock: In stock 171
Code: KF23011
Your Price: £34.84 exc VATRRP: £34.84 exc VAT
Pack size: 50
Stock: In stock 221
Code: KF23012
Your Price: £34.84 exc VATRRP: £34.84 exc VAT
Pack size: 50
Stock: Out of stock, check with us for a due date.
Code: KF23013
Your Price: £34.84 exc VATRRP: £34.84 exc VAT
Pack size: 50
Stock: In stock 19
Code: KF23014
Your Price: £34.84 exc VATRRP: £34.84 exc VAT
Pack size: 50
Stock: In stock 172
Code: KF23015
Your Price: £34.84 exc VATRRP: £34.84 exc VAT
Pack size: 50
Stock: In stock 219
Code: KF23016
Your Price: £34.84 exc VATRRP: £34.84 exc VAT
Pack size: 50
Stock: In stock 206
Code: KF23017
Your Price: £34.84 exc VATRRP: £34.84 exc VAT
Pack size: 50
Stock: Out of stock, check with us for a due date.
Code: KF23025
Your Price: £27.32 exc VATRRP: £27.32 exc VAT
Pack size: 1
Stock: In stock 1,335
Code: KF24001
Your Price: £9.74 exc VATRRP: £9.74 exc VAT
Pack size: 1
Stock: In stock
Code: KF24002
Your Price: £18.49 exc VATRRP: £18.49 exc VAT
Pack size: 1
Stock: In stock 4,656
Code: KF25001
Your Price: £59.94 exc VATRRP: £59.94 exc VAT
Pack size: 50
Stock: In stock 531